New single out now - Julegaven (the Christmas Gift)

Trine Rein's Christmas album, Julegaven (the Christmas Gift) was released in 2011, followed by her first Christmas concert tour by the same title. Ever since she embarked on her Christmas concert journey she has always wanted to have a title song to go along with her Christmas production. Now, on the fifth anniversary of her Christmas tour, her has come true, and a title song is finally making her Christmas production - Julegaven - complete. This year, the Christmas single, Julegaven, was created in several stages starting with a talk around the breakfast table between Trine and her husband, Lars Monsen. Trine told Lars about how she had wanted to write a title song to her Christmas project, and that she wanted it to embrace the message about Divine love - the foundation of her Christmas tours. A wave of inspiration caught Lars, and he began to speak in beautiful phrases potentially worthy to be the lyrics of a new song. Trine wrote down every word, and was moved by the strong statements given by her husband as they did indeed embrace her original idea for the song.

After writing down all the beautiful statements, Trine first decided to contact her friend and colleague, Trygve Skaug, to help her put the statements into a lyric and a song. She invited Trygve, as well as her guest artist and opera singer for this year's Christmas tour, Eli Kristin Hanssveen, to her home to co-write the song which eventually became the new single, Julegaven.

There is also a video to go with the new single. This video is shot during Trine's journey to Uganda in August 2017 in collaboration with relief organization Mission Aviation Fellowship, MAF.no. Trine has invited MAF Norway to join her on her Christmas tour in order to expand the understanding of the Christmas gift. This collaboration enables Trines audience to learn about how MAF Norway works, and provides an opportunity to support by giving the most valuable Christmas gift this year - saving lives.

Trine Rein launches her Christmas tour with new, featured artist! A few years back, a strong spiritual experience created the foundation to Trine Rein's project, Julegaven (The Christmas Gift). Like in previous years, this year she wishes to fill her Norwegian audience with the Christmas spirit, and she is going on a major Christmas concert tour covering all of 37 churches around the country. 

 

Earlier, Rein has worked with various local children-, teen-, and adult choirs, and this year they are replaced by opera singer Eli Kristin Hanssveen as her featured artist.

With these strong and varied voices together, the audience is guaranteed a vast musical experience with a bouquet of everything between classical pearls and popular Christmas music.

What Rein offers is not the traditional Christmas concert:

"I wish to create excitement and happiness in church, and my concerts include an element of humor as well as the more solemn moments. Additionally, I want to share the message of love for my audience to take home for Christmas", she explains.

The tour is also a collaboration with relief organization Mission Aviation Fellowship (MAF), with which Trine recently visited one of the refugee camps in Uganda in preparation for the tour. She will share more about this mission during the concert.

MAF is a world wide relief organization flying much needed supplies, medical equipment and medical personell to the hardest-to-reach, and most often troubled areas of the world. Every third minute one of MAF's 140 airplanes take off or land on a mission in one of the 25 countries they operate within - in Asia, South-America or in Africa. They are politically neutral, and help other relief organizations in transporting necessary aid and supplies to various disaster struck areas.

Happy New Year 2017!

Happy New Year, guys! I hope your year has been a great one so far, and if not, it's still early...😊

I've got great plans this year! For two years now, I have been working on a new album together with Ronni le Tekrø and Tony Carey. Ronni was on board for the beginning of the project, and after creating three songs together which all made the album, Tony and I continued collaborating both live, and also to create the rest of the album material. It has been a long process, indeed, and an exciting, educating and interesting journey!

The idea for the album was born when my husband, Lars Monsen, surprised me on my birthday by taking me to a Zappa Union concert in Oslo. I didn't even know I would like that sort of music, but upon leaving the concert venue, I was more inspired than I can recall. The music they played took me on a musical journey visiting almost any and all musical genres imaginable on the way. It was almost like getting a musical shower, and I remember wanting the concert to just continue into eternity. My first thought was, "how can I make music like that?" So I called up my most openminded, crazy and creative friend and colleague, Ronni, who was eager to start playing with the ideas I had. He insisted on taking Tony Carey on board, and the three of us began working in Ronni's studio shortly after. To make a long story short, my upcoming album is now ready to be released, and the official release date for The Well is Jan. 27, 2017.

The album will be available via streaming, downloads, CD and - oh yes! Vinyl!! This will be my first vinyl release since my debut with the album Finders Keepers as a solo artist.
